Business: Regulation

Volume 497: debated on Wednesday 14 October 2009

To ask the Minister of State, Department for Business, Innovation and Skills what recent estimate his Department has made of the cost to UK businesses of the administrative burden of regulation. (290233)

In May 2005, the administrative cost of regulations was measured using the internationally recognised Standard Cost Model. The measurement exercise included 19 Government Departments, regulators and agencies. The burden was estimated at £13.2 billion annually. The Government have committed to reduce administrative burdens associated with complying with regulations by 25 per cent. net by May 2010. As at December 2008, an estimated £1.9 billion net annual savings had been delivered.
